LeadingAge Ohio names Susan Wallace next President/CEO

Wallace brings over a decade of policy experience to role

This week, LeadingAge Ohio announced that its Board of Directors has named Susan Wallace, Chief Policy Officer for LeadingAge Ohio, as its next President/CEO. Current President/CEO Kathryn Brod announced in August of 2021 that she planned to retire following a long career in senior living, corporate finance, and association leadership.

Wallace was selected through a member search committee process facilitated by the Deffet Group, and confirmed Friday by the LeadingAge Ohio Board of Directors.

“On behalf of the LeadingAge Ohio Board of Directors, we are more than confident in the selection of Susan Wallace in this new role,” stated Allison Q. Salopeck, CEO of Jennings in Garfield Heights and LeadingAge Ohio Board Chair. “She will continue to provide strong leadership and advocacy that is necessary to support the members in current and future needs. We are grateful and proud of the work led by Kathryn, who will leave us in a position of strength.”

Wallace began at LeadingAge Ohio following eight years with the Midwest Care Alliance prior to its merger with LeadingAge Ohio in 2014. Wallace has steered advocacy work for LeadingAge Ohio since 2019, serving as spokesperson and subject matter expert for Medicaid reimbursement and other policy issues. She began her career as a social worker with Mount Carmel Hospice prior to stepping into various quality-related roles at the Midwest Care Alliance, including operating a multi-state quality improvement program and advising the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services on the development of standardized quality measures for hospices.

Wallace will assume leadership of the organization on March 15, following the retirement of Kathryn Brod.

"I have seen Susan grow over the years into a respected policy expert and leader for our field, and I can't think of a better individual to take over as the next President/CEO of LeadingAge Ohio,” said Brod. “Her expertise, strength, and compassion will serve our members and staff well as they continue to build upon the progress we've achieved."

Brod began as President/CEO of LeadingAge Ohio in 2014. She has been a tireless advocate for older Ohioans and the aging services workforce. Achievements during her nearly eight years as President/CEO include steering the association through four successive state budgets, navigating an ongoing workforce crisis, and leading the association through a global pandemic which struck hardest in the long-term care sector.

LeadingAge Ohio represents nearly 400 predominantly nonprofit providers of aging services and post-acute care around the state of Ohio.
